Key Features
Mabl
- Auto-healing tests that adapt to UI changes without manual intervention.
- Visual testing to compare screenshots and detect visual discrepancies.
- Intelligent test creation using AI to suggest optimal test cases.
- Seamless integration with CI/CD pipelines for continuous testing.
- Detailed analytics and reporting on test execution and results.

Mabl Pros
- + Streamlines test automation with AI-driven capabilities, reducing manual effort.
- + Offers robust integration with popular development tools, enhancing workflow efficiency.
- + Provides auto-healing features that significantly reduce test maintenance time.
- + Supports comprehensive cross-browser and mobile testing, ensuring broad coverage.
- + Facilitates data-driven testing, improving test accuracy and reliability.
- + Enhances team collaboration with seamless integration into existing workflows.
Mabl Cons
- − May require initial setup time to fully integrate with existing systems.
- − Advanced features might have a learning curve for new users.
- − Pricing may be a barrier for smaller teams with limited budgets.
- − Customization options are extensive but may require technical expertise.
- − Limited offline capabilities as it relies on cloud-based operations.
